`
gip666
  • 浏览: 40175 次
  • 性别: Icon_minigender_1
  • 来自: 北京
社区版块
存档分类
最新评论

sqlplus copy

 
阅读更多
当两个数据库服务器不能相互链接时,我们需求定时的去将一个数据库的数据导入到另一个数据库,这时候第三台服务器可连接两台服务器,这时候就要使用SQLPLUS COPY。
如下语句,使用批处理执行

column table_name new_value table_name ;
select to_char(sysdate-1,'yymmdd') table_name  from dual;

copy from abc/abc@IP1:1521/orcl to abc/abc@IP2:1521/orcl create  copy_test&&table_name  using select *  from copy_test_&&table_name;

其中表名是每天动态生成的按天分表
分享到:
评论

相关推荐

    OL1.sqlplus环境和常用命令

    连接字符串通常包括数据库服务器的SID或服务名(Service Name),例如`sqlplus scott/tiger@orcl`。如果已配置了TNSNames.ora,可以直接使用服务名代替连接字符串。 二、SQL*Plus基本操作 1. **查询(SELECT)**:...

    Oracel移行方法のまとめ

    - 数据量:小规模数据适合使用SQLPLUS COPY,大规模数据则考虑expdp/impdp或Transportable Tablespaces。 - 时间限制:如果时间紧迫,CTAS和INSERT SELECT (DB LINK)是高效的选择。 - 安全性:RMAN提供数据一致性...

    ORACLE SQLPLUS 命令大全

    * COPY:用于复制数据 * DEFINE:用于定义报表的变量 * DEL:用于删除报表的行 * DESCRIPTOR:用于描述报表的结构 * DISCONNECT:用于断开数据库连接 * EDIT:用于编辑报表的内容 * EXECUTE:用于执行报表的语句 * ...

    oracle的sqlplus学习笔记.docx

    本地命令在 SQLPlus 本地执行,不发送给服务器,例如:`COPY`、`COMPUTE`、`REM` 和 `SET LINESIZE`。服务器命令不在 SQLPlus 本地执行,而是通过服务器进行处理,例如:`CREATE TABLE` 和 `INSERT` 的 SQL 命令,...

    sqlplus环境变量.docsqlplus环境变量.doc

    6. **COPYCOMMIT**:在使用COPY命令时,控制是否在每一行复制后提交,默认是不提交。 7. **ECHO**:控制是否显示输入的SQL语句,ON表示显示,OFF则不显示。 8. **EMBEDDED**:开启或关闭嵌入式SQL支持。 9. **...

    Oracle9i通过RMAN的copy方式迁移数据测试报告

    Oracle9i通过RMAN的copy方式迁移数据是一个较为复杂的过程,涉及到多个Oracle数据库管理和存储技术的概念。本文将对上述文档中提及的知识点进行详细说明。 ### Oracle9i数据库基础 **Oracle9i** 是甲骨文公司...

    oracle的sqlplus配置

    解决方法是注释掉`wrapper.env.copy=DISPLAY`这一行。操作命令为: ``` $ vi $ORACLE_HOME/Apache/Jserv/etc/jserv.properties #wrapper.env.copy=DISPLAY ``` #### 三、配置TNS_NAMES 为了使SQL*Plus能够成功连接...

    SQLPLUS命令编程手册[总结].pdf

    `#`、`DEL`、`QUIT`、`$`、`DESCRIBE`、`REMARK`、`/`、`DISCONNECT`、`RUN`...SQLPLUS`、`CLEAR`、`HOST`、`START`、`CTITLE`、`INPUT`、`TIMING`、`COMPUTE`、`LIST`、`TTITLE`、`CONNECT`、`NEWPAGE`、`UNDEFINE`、`...

    oracle的sqlplus学习笔记分享.pdf

    本地命令(如`COPY`, `COMPUTE`, `REM`, `SET LINESIZE`)在本地执行,不涉及服务器;服务器命令(如`CREATE TABLE`, `INSERT`, PL/SQL块)通过服务器处理,需要分号或反斜杠结束。 6. **SET命令**:`SET`是SQL*...

    数据库基础

    §10.1.9 关于 COPY命令 218 §10.1.10 列值为NULL情形的处理 219 §10.1.11 使用 product_user_file来限制用户使用产品 220 §10.2 常用技巧 221 §10.2.1 long 类型的查询 222 §10.2.2 如何确定执行时间 222 §...

    oracle数据库同步交换的方法-我收集的常见

    6. **SQLPLUS的COPY命令**:SQLPLUS的COPY命令可以用来快速地在本地和远程数据库之间复制数据,但可能不适用于复杂的同步需求。 7. **EXP/IMP工具**:通过EXP导出增量数据,然后在目标数据库使用IMP导入,可以实现...

    华南农业大学-《数据库系统》实验报告(全)

    copy`等操作系统命令。 - **将输出重定向至文件:** 使用`spool c:\textoutput.txt;`将查询结果保存到文件中。 4. **显示系统信息:** - **显示用户信息:** 执行`show user;`命令。 - **显示数据库版本信息:**...

    plsql导出数据到excel的三种方法

    2. **导出数据**:在查询结果集上,即在结果显示区域(注意不要选中任何具体的行或单元格),点击鼠标右键,选择【Copy to Excel】选项下的【Copy as xls/xlsx】,将数据导出为Excel文件。需要注意的是,根据PL/SQL ...

    dos常用命令

    - 示例:`copy C:\Users\YourName\example.txt C:\Backup` 将example.txt文件复制到Backup目录下。 #### 6. **`rd` - 删除目录** - `rd`命令用于删除空目录。 - 注意:只能删除空目录。 #### 7. **`del` - 删除...

    RMAN备份命令详解

    1. %sqlplus /nolog 2. SQL> conn / as sysdba 3. SQL> shutdown immediate; 4. SQL> startup mount; 5. SQL> alter database archivelog; 6. SQL> alter database open; 7. SQL> alter system archive log start; ...

    常见linux命令

    - **SCP (Secure Copy):** `scp -r -P 51881 192.168.3.10:/tmp/pager.jsp .` 此命令将远程服务器(192.168.3.10)上的文件`pager.jsp`复制到本地当前目录下。`-r`表示递归复制整个目录结构,`-P`指定非标准的...

    dos常用命令.。。。。。。。

    - `sqlplus username/password@service_name`:登录到数据库。 - `sqlplus /nolog`:不登录的情况下启动SQL*Plus。 #### 3. SHUTDOWN - **功能**:关闭数据库实例。 - **用法**: - `shutdown normal`:等待所有...

    oracle备份和dba

    - 使用`host copy`命令复制数据文件到备份目录:`SQL> host copy D:\oracle\oradata\orcl\*.dbf D:\BAK\`。 - 结束表空间的备份模式:`SQL> alter tablespace users end backup`。 - 切换日志文件以确保所有的...

    oracle数据文件迁移

    1. 打开命令行窗口,输入 `sqlplus / as sysdba` 并回车,登录 Oracle 数据库。 2. 输入 `shutdown immediate` 命令关闭数据库,系统将提示“数据库已经关闭”。 二、迁移数据文件 迁移数据文件的目的是将要迁移的...

    linux-oracle数据同步到Greenplum的shell脚本

    可以使用`COPY`命令,或者通过`gpfdist`服务配合`gpload`工具实现批量数据加载。 在`oracle-to-greenplum-master`这个文件中,可能包含的就是实现上述步骤的shell脚本。脚本可能分为几个部分: - **配置部分**:...

Global site tag (gtag.js) - Google Analytics